Default 2000 Silverado 4.8 lacks power at temperature

Mods in sig. When cold the truck runs great. All kinds of power, will blow the tires off through second gear as long as you keep your foot in it but as soon as it gets some temperature in it the power is gone. Forgot to mention that it also has 30 pound injectors. Dont know what tune is in it as I just got it and havent had a chance to get it on HP Tuners but any ideas???

Originally Posted by nitrouspowrdss
Non intercooled, dunno if its tuned or not and I just got the truck and as long as I have had it it has been this way
That sums it up right there. Those non intercooled vortechs are fire breathers. Once that truck gets hot is it pulling all of the timing out. Take it to a dyno shop and have them tune it for you.
